bioprocessing equipment plays a crucial role in the biotech industry, as it is essential for the production of biopharmaceuticals, vaccines, enzymes, and other biotech products. This equipment is used to carry out various processes in the manufacturing of biotech products, such as cell culture, fermentation, purification, and filtration. bioprocessing equipment ensures the efficient and precise production of high-quality biotech products, making it a vital component of the biotech industry.

One of the key functions of bioprocessing equipment is cell culture, which is the process of growing cells in a controlled environment. This process is essential for the production of biopharmaceuticals, as it allows for the growth of cells that will be used to produce the desired product. Bioreactors are a type of bioprocessing equipment used in cell culture, as they provide an ideal environment for cells to grow and reproduce. Bioreactors come in various sizes and designs, depending on the specific requirements of the process and the type of cells being cultured.

Another critical function of bioprocessing equipment is fermentation, which is the process of converting raw materials into valuable biotech products through the action of microorganisms. Fermentation equipment, such as fermenters and bioreactors, plays a crucial role in this process by providing the optimal conditions for microorganisms to grow and produce the desired product. The design and functionality of fermentation equipment can significantly impact the efficiency and yield of the fermentation process, making it essential for the successful production of biotech products.

Purification is another key process in bioprocessing, as it involves separating and purifying the desired product from the cell culture or fermentation broth. Various types of bioprocessing equipment, such as chromatography columns, filtration systems, and centrifuges, are used in purification processes to achieve high purity and yield of the final product. These equipment are designed to remove impurities, contaminants, and by-products from the product stream, ensuring the production of a high-quality biotech product.

Filtration is also an essential process in bioprocessing, as it is used to separate solids from liquids and gases in the production of biotech products. Filtration equipment, such as membrane filters, depth filters, and sterile filters, are used to remove particles, microorganisms, and other impurities from the product stream to ensure its safety and quality. Filtration equipment plays a vital role in bioprocessing, as it helps to maintain the purity and integrity of the product throughout the manufacturing process.
